Such a big sun (spoilers): Hélène, irresponsible for her actions? This intriguing track


On May 17 in Un si grand soleil, the Senso is the victim of a smear campaign, Virgile has a fit of jealousy at Alix, while Hélène’s lawyer is intrigued by a lead.

In the episode ofsuch a big sun of Tuesday, May 17, the Senso is the victim ofa smear campaign on social networks. Comments are posted en masse, comparing it to a brothel. Justine (Dorylia Calmel) thinks that a defamation complaint should be filed, while Virgile (Fred Bianconi) prefers to ignore these messages. Which does not seem to tarnish the reputation of this club too much, since at the same time, Dimitri (Victorien Robert) pushes his friend Maxime to come to the Friday evening. At the club, Alix (Nadia Fossier) and Virgile are visited by Céline Dufy (Anne-Laure Gruet) who has good news for the two partners. The town hall did not object to their request for a building permit and it has proposals to submit to them on their future installation of a spa. Except that Virgil is hardly concentrated during this work meeting.

Once Celine left, the tension is at its peak between the two partners. Alix criticizes Virgil for not having ordered enough alcohol for their evening, while he claims to be more competent in terms of stock management due to his past experience. He takes the opportunity to throw a pike at her, considering that she mixes up work and personal stories too much, before blame him directly for having slept with Dimitri. A fit of jealousy that amuses and delights Alix, who nevertheless wanted to make it clear to her lover that she only slept with him.

Could Hélène benefit from a dismissal?

Hélène (Sophie Le Tellier) receives the visit of a lawyer, Master Levars, ready to defend. She is delighted that finally someone recognizes that she is a victim in this case. She believes that she has nothing to do in prison, since she has done nothing wrong. Above all, Hélène takes advantage of the presence of her lawyer to tell him of her concern for Claire (Mélanie Maudran). She complains that he is prevented from seeing her. According to Hélène, it is Florent (Fabrice Deville) who fomented this plot against her. It is also probably him who forbids Claire to visit him. She asks her lawyer to convey to the nurse the fact that she constantly thinks of her. At the end of this exchange, Serge Levars calls judge Alphand (Marie-Gaëlle Cals) to warn her that he is counting ask for a dismissal, the place of his client being in a psychiatric hospital and not in prison. This goes against the conclusion of the expert who examined it. Cécile is convinced that Hélène was in full possession of her faculties, especially since she acted not out of sheer madness but for months.

After some thought, Claire announces to Janet (Tonya Kinzinger) that she accepts his offer to return to her job at the hospital. He missed teamwork. She wants to forget what happened with Hélène and reconnect with the team. As the hospital is understaffed, she is expected the next day to resume his duties. When she returns home, Claire meets Louis who had come to work on his lessons with Kira (Coline Ramos-Pinto). The complicity of the two teenagers did not escape Claire who, once Louis left, did not hesitate to tease Kira about it. But she assures him that they are just friends. For his part, immersed in Hélène’s file, Serge Levars calls Laetitia (Shirley Bousquet) to warn her that he will finish late. The latter will therefore take the opportunity to participate in an impromptu dinner organized by her colleagues in honor of Nadia, her deputy director who will be returning from sick leave. She suffered from insomnia and behavioral problems. In question ? The side effects of a medication she was taking for her migraines. As soon as she stopped this treatment, her seizures disappeared. Information that tilts with the lawyer. He immediately calls David (Quentin Gratias) to ask him what treatment Hélène is taking. He hopes to follow this lead.
